Hundreds of mourners on Friday gathered at Kabagoma Village in Ibanda District to pay their final respects to celebrated Catholic liturgical music icon John Bosco Kazoora during his burial ceremony.
Kazoora, widely admired for his contribution to Catholic liturgical music, was praised for using music to strengthen the faith of Christians and inspire generations of worshippers within the Catholic Church.
While leading the funeral Mass, Severinus Ndugwa described the late Kazoora as a devoted servant of God whose music ministry touched countless lives.

Ndugwa noted that Kazoora’s songs played a significant role in evangelization and deepening spirituality among Catholics, saying his contribution to the Church would never be forgotten.
He also challenged young people to emulate Kazoora’s determination and hard work, noting that despite his humble educational background, he pursued his passion and rose to become one of the most respected figures in Catholic liturgical music.
Kazoora passed away on Monday, May 4, 2026, just days after celebrating his sacrament of holy matrimony on April 25, 2026, a development that has left many believers in shock and sorrow.
